The EnGenius ESR750H Wi-Fi router is designed to deliver extended range and expanded coverage so your family can connect more devices throughout and around your home and take advantage of all the free and subscription-based Internet services now available on Blu-ray players, game consoles, set top boxes, HDTVs and more. Users can also connect a USB hard drive to share its content throughout the home. This intelligent router also includes shAir which enables users to connect a USB-enabled speaker to the router’s USB port for streaming music from iTunes-enabled devices like iPhones, computers, and AppleTVs. The ESR750H comes with the detachable 5dBi high gain external antennas and is embedded with internal high gain antennas to extend wireless signal range and provide greater coverage and better connectivity to remote devices. The ESR750H also supports several security features and settings including industry standard wireless encryption, such as WEP, WPA/WPA2 to prevent unauthorized access to the network; an advanced SPI (Stateful Packet Inspection) firewall to block malicious software from the Internet from accessing networked devices; MAC Address filtering to grant only known computers and devices network access; and URL filtering to block access to unwanted or offensive websites. Users can also enable up to four separate and discrete SSIDs (Service Set Identifiers) or ways to access the network. This gives families the ability to offer friends or visitors Internet access or access to specific devices, like printers, while protecting other networked computers or hard drives in the home that may contain private information. This smart router also employs intelligent QoS (Quality of Service) to prioritize bandwidth-intensive applications like HD video and gaming or bandwidth sensitive applications like VoIP (Voice over IP) telephone calls for optimal connectivity.
